Overview

Alta Lake is Whistler's historic lake, located just south of Green Lake in the Sea-to-Sky corridor. It's the oldest and most popular lake in Whistler, surrounded by parks and trails. The southerly thermal wind develops in the afternoon, channelled by the valley. Several public access points including Rainbow Park and Lakeside Park.

On the water

Fresh water. Flat to slightly choppy. The lake is about 2.5 km long — moderate fetch along the N-S axis. Sand and mud bottom. Cold water (13-20°C in summer). Moderate depth. More sheltered conditions than Squamish.

Hazards

Heavy traffic in summer: canoes, kayaks, paddleboards, swimmers. Gusty wind in the mountain corridor. Cold water — wetsuit recommended. The lake is popular and space can be limited on nice days.
